Phoenician Plumbing assesses every drain cleaning job in Pico Rivera, CA before starting work. For main sewer lines and recurring clogs, we use video inspection to see the exact obstruction type and location so we select the right clearing method.
Our Pico Rivera plumber clears your drain using professional equipment. Kitchen drains with grease buildup benefit from hydro-jetting, while bathroom clogs typically respond well to mechanical snaking. We use the method that clears the obstruction completely.
After clearing, we run water through the drain to verify full flow is restored and confirm no secondary blockages are present further down the line.
Phoenician Plumbing closes every drain cleaning job in Pico Rivera, CA with practical prevention advice tailored to what caused your clog. We recommend the right maintenance intervals and any improvements — like root barrier treatments or trap upgrades — that reduce recurrence.

Most Pico Rivera homeowners benefit from professional drain cleaning every 1 to 2 years as preventive maintenance. Kitchen drains in households that cook frequently may need annual service. Homes with large trees near the sewer line should have the main line inspected and cleared annually to prevent root buildup from causing backups.
The most common causes of clogged drains in Pico Rivera homes are grease and food particles in kitchen drains, hair and soap scum in bathroom drains, tree root intrusion in main sewer lines, mineral scale buildup from hard water, and flushing non-flushable items that get stuck in the sewer line. Each type requires a different clearing approach.
Yes. Tree roots are one of the most common causes of sewer line problems in Pico Rivera neighborhoods with mature trees. Roots enter through small cracks or joints in older sewer lines and grow inside the pipe, eventually causing recurring blockages, complete blockages, or pipe collapse. Annual hydro-jetting and a root treatment can control root growth and extend line life.
Chemical drain cleaners are generally not recommended for Pico Rivera homes with older plumbing. The caustic chemicals can accelerate corrosion in metal pipes and degrade older PVC joints over time. They also rarely clear blockages completely and can make the problem worse by causing debris to compact. Professional drain cleaning by Phoenician Plumbing is safer and more effective.
